Summertime means removing spent flowers from perennials as they complete their bloom cycle. Repeat blooming daylilies are one type of Hemerocallis that will perform even better for you if you take the time to do this task.

Daylilies are strong performers in the garden.

Perennials - How to deadhead a Daylily (2)Pictured here is the everblooming Stella D'Oro daylily. Basically starting in May this perennial will begin its display of golden, yellow flowering and keep going right up until a hard frost. If you deadhead them (cut off the old flower stalks at the base) you will get even more blossoms than if you leave the stalks up to form seed pods which over the summer will ripen and burst in the fall.

While it isn't necessary, doing it will get you better performance. And let's face it: in a perennial garden, flower power is everything!

If the plant is spending all its energy and nutrient stores to form seeds, then there is that much less available to form flowers. By deadheading, you are conserving and redirecting energy toward flower production.

Plus...the plant looks super once all those seed pods are removed!

How to keep your daylilies blooming all summer? ›

Reblooming daylilies flower continuously, more or less all summer long. The keys to keeping rebloomers blooming are watering and deadheading. Drought will slow down flower production, but deadheading is even more important. Every third day, religiously deadhead not just the blossoms, but the ovary behind the bloom.

Will daylilies bloom again if you deadhead them? ›

By deadheading, you're telling the plant to make flowers, not seed. Depending on the variety, a quick snip encourages the plant to send up new stems and buds. This is especially true for reblooming varieties like Happy Returns, Rosy Returns and Pardon Me.

How to deadhead perennials? ›

Deadheading is very simple. As blooms fade, pinch or cut off the flower stems below the spent flowers and just above the first set of full, healthy leaves. Always check plants carefully to be sure that no flower buds are hiding amid the faded blooms before you shear off the top of the plant.

How many times do daylilies bloom in summer? ›

Individual flowers last a day, but plants typically open successive blooms over four to five weeks. Rebloomers offer several performances yearly, while a handful of daylilies called everbloomers flower nearly all summer.

Why don't my daylilies keep blooming? ›

The number one reason daylilies aren't blooming well is lack of sunlight. Make sure your plant is getting at least six hours of direct sunlight per day to bloom profusely. Examine the lighting conditions and, if necessary, relocate the plant to a brighter spot.

How to keep lilies blooming all summer? ›

For dependable blooms, lilies should get 6 to 8 hours of direct sunlight daily (aka “full sun”). If it's too shady, the stems will attempt to lean toward the sun or get spindly and fall over. Also, a well-drained site is critical. Water trapped beneath the scales may rot the bulb.
